What are 8 ball pool balls called?
The game of 8-ball pool consists of playing with 1 white cue ball and 15 numbered balls called object balls. The balls numbered 1 through 7 are called solids. The balls numbered 9 through 15 are called stripes.Why is 8 ball pool called 8 ball pool?
The game of eight-ball arose around 1900 in the United States as a development of pyramid pool, which allows any eight of the fifteen object balls to be pocketed to win.What are the balls in pool called?
A set of pool balls consists of one white cue ball and 15 colour-coded numbered balls. The balls numbered 1 through 8 have solid colours and the balls numbered 9 through 15 are white with a centre band of colour.Is there an eight ball in pool?
The balls numbered one through eight are solids, while nine through fifteen are striped. You also need a solid white or yellow cue ball, a rack, and pool cue sticks.The Rules of 8 Ball Pool (Eight Ball Pool) - EXPLAINED!

eight ball, also called stripes and solids, popular American pocket-billiards game in which 15 balls numbered consecutively and a white cue ball are used.What is the white ball called in pool?
The name is a reference to how many balls need to be pocketed to win the game, but all 15 balls are used. All of the striped and colored balls are referred to as object balls, and the solid white ball is the cue ball.What are all the kinds of 8-ball?
The game has numerous variations, including Alabama eight-ball, crazy eight, last pocket, misery, Missouri, 1 and 15 in the sides, rotation eight ball, soft eight, and others.What is the first shot in pool called?

Billiards is played on a table without pockets. The game only has three balls, which are red, white (with a spot), and another white one (without a spot). Pool involves a table with six pockets. You need 15 balls, but some people play with just nine.Is blackball the same as 8-ball?
Blackball is a standardized version of the English version of eight-ball. The two main sets of playing rules are those of the World Pool-Billiard Association (WPA), known as "blackball rules", and the older code of the World Eightball Pool Federation (WEPF), often referred to as "world rules".Do you call the black ball in pool?

Don't Get Behind the Eight Ball!The phrase behind the eight ball derives from the game of pool where you're not supposed to hit the eight ball into a pocket. If one is behind the eight ball, they are in a tough or losing situation.
What does it mean to drop the eight ball?
In trouble or an awkward position, out of luck, as in His check bounced, leaving Jim behind the eight ball with his landlord. The term comes from pocket billiards or pool, where in certain games if the number eight ball is between the “cue ball” and “object ball” the player cannot make a straight shot.
